County Road School

130 County Rd
Demarest, NJ 07627
(School attendance zone shown in map)
County Road School serves 191 students in grades Prekindergarten-1. 
The student:teacher ratio of 11:1 is equal to the New Jersey state level of 11:1.
Minority enrollment is 43% of the student body (majority Asian), which is lower than the New Jersey state average of 61% (majority Hispanic and Black).

County Road School's student population of 191 students has grown by 17% over five school years.
The teacher population of 17 teachers has grown by 13% over five school years.
